Cold amp settings — Line 6 Spider iv 75
The At the gates guitar tone for “Cold”, dialed in for a Line 6 Spider iv 75 with a Kramer Striker HSS. Studio version, Slaughter of the Soul (1995) - Main rhythm guitar track
Boss HM-2 into 5150 / Peavey solid-state (Studio Fredman blend), Ibanez guitars with bridge humbuckers tuned to B standard
| Knob | Setting (0–10) |
|---|---|
| Gain | 6 |
| Bass | 5 |
| Mid | 7 |
| Treble | 7 |
| Reverb | 0 |
| Master | 4 |
01Boss SD-1 Super Overdrive
Used strictly as a clean boost to tighten sub-bass flub and push the front-end attack
02Boss NS-2 Noise Suppressor
Essential to clamp high-gain hiss and keep fast alternate picking articulate
03MXR M108S 10-Band EQ
Boost 1kHz and 2kHz bands slightly to capture the signature Swedish chainsaw upper-mid bite
The Spider IV Insane channel already delivers massive gain, so amp gain is kept at 6 to avoid turning into fizzy mush. The SD-1 acts purely as a low-cut tightener with Drive at 0, while the MXR 10-band EQ handles the critical 1-2kHz midrange spike that defines the Studio Fredman tone. Your Kramer bridge humbucker matches the high-output attack needed for this record.
